Abstract
600,636. Regulating. FABIAN, H. E. Sept. 27, 1945, No. 25096. Convention date, Oct. 5, 1944. [Class 7 (vi)] In an engine having an air throttle 14 operated conjointly with the control rod 18 of a fuel injection pump 1, automatic correction of the air-fuel mixture is obtained under varying load by a compensator operated as a function of the engine speed. In Fig. 1, a centrifugal governor 2 controls an eccentricallypivoted lever 6 connected to an eccentric pivot 10 supporting a compensating lever 11 connected to the throttle 14 and to the control rod 18 through a lever 17 pivoted at 17a and sliding in a knuckle joint 16. Opening of the throttle 14 causes the rod 18 to move in the direction F to increase the fuel supply, but as the speed rises the governor 2 rotates lever 6, causing the lever 11 to rotate about the point 20 and move rod 18 in the opposite direction to correct the fuel supply in accordance with increased pump efficiency at higher speeds. The positioning of the joint 16 arranges that the correction increases progressively with opening of the throttle 14. A capsule 22 actuating a lever 21 further adjusts the fuel supply for varying atmospheric temperature and pressure, and manual operation of a button 31 connected to an abutment 32 rotates the lever 21 to enrich the mixture at starting. In a modification, the centrifugal governor is replaced by a spring-controlled piston actuated by hydraulic pressure supplied by an enginedriven pump.
